Fort Lauderdale-Hollywood International Airport (FLL) serves as the departure point, with flights arriving at Rafael Núñez International Airport (CTG) in Cartagena, Colombia.
Three major carriers operate premium cabin service on this route: American Airlines, LATAM Airlines, and Delta Air Lines. Each airline connects FLL to CTG with at least one stop, typically routing through hubs such as Miami International Airport (MIA), Bogotá's El Dorado International Airport (BOG), or Atlanta Hartsfield-Jackson International Airport (ATL). Total travel time averages around 8 hours depending on connection layovers, making premium cabin comfort a genuine priority rather than a luxury indulgence for this itinerary.

What makes Cartagena a compelling destination for business travelers? The city is Colombia's fastest-growing meetings and incentive travel market, with the Cartagena Convention Center hosting over 200 international events annually. The walled city's historic center sits within 20 minutes of Rafael Núñez International Airport (CTG), making it unusually efficient for executives with tight schedules. Business class seating on this route means arriving rested and ready for client meetings, conference sessions, or site visits without the fatigue of economy travel on an 8-hour itinerary.
